يتم استخدام امتداد ملف PSB و Photoshop Big لتخزين معلومات ضخمة متعلقة بالرسومات. يمكنك تحويل ملفات PSB إلى تنسيق PDF أو JPG أو PSD بسهولة باستخدام لغة برمجة Java. دعنا نتصفح الأقسام التالية لاستكشاف تحويل ملف PSB:

محول PSB إلى PDF أو JPG أو PSD - تثبيت Java API

Aspose.PSD for Java تقدم API ميزات مختلفة للعمل مع ملفات PSB. علاوة على ذلك ، يمكن استخدامه في الكثير من بيئات النظام وأنظمة التشغيل بسبب دعم منصة Java. يمكنك تنزيل ملف JAR بسرعة أو تهيئته في التطبيقات المستندة إلى Maven من Aspose Repository. فيما يلي تكوينات إعداد API في بيئتك:

مخزن:

<repositories>
    <repository>
        <id>AsposeJavaAPI</id>
        <name>Aspose Java API</name>
        <url>http://repository.aspose.com/repo/</url>
    </repository>
</repositories>

الاعتماد:

 <dependencies>
    <dependency>
        <groupId>com.aspose</groupId>
        <artifactId>aspose-psd</artifactId>
        <version>20.9</version>
        <classifier>jdk16</classifier>
   </dependency>
</dependencies>

تحويل PSB إلى PDF برمجيًا باستخدام Java

تنسيق PDF هو تنسيق مستند ثابت وهو نوع جدير بالثقة لتمثيل المعلومات. يمكنك تحويل ملف PSB إلى مستند PDF باتباع الخطوات البسيطة التالية:

  1. حدد مسار ملف إدخال PSB
  2. تحميل ملف إدخال PSB
  3. تحويل ملف PSB إلى PDF باستخدام [PdfOptions] (https://reference.aspose.com/psd/java/com.aspose.psd.imageoptions/PdfOptions)

تؤدي هذه الخطوات البسيطة إلى تحويل ملف PSB إلى تنسيق PDF ولا داعي للقلق بشأن أي تفاصيل أساسية لملف الإدخال أو الإخراج. يوضح الكود التالي كيفية تحويل PSB إلى PDF برمجيًا باستخدام Java:

// حدد مسار إدخال ملف PSB
String sourceFileName = dataDir + "Simple.psb";
     
// تحميل ملف إدخال PSB  
PsdImage image = (PsdImage)Image.load(sourceFileName);          
       
// تحويل ملف PSB إلى PDF
image.save(dataDir + "Simple_output.pdf",new PdfOptions());

تحويل PSB إلى صورة JPG برمجيًا باستخدام Java

قد تحتاج أحيانًا إلى تحويل ملف PSB إلى صورة JPG لمعاينة سريعة للبيانات والمعلومات. تحتاج إلى اتباع الخطوات التالية لإجراء هذا التحويل:

  1. تحميل ملف إدخال PSB
  2. تهيئة JpegOptions كائن فئة
  3. تحويل ملف صورة PSB إلى JPG

يوضح الكود التالي كيفية تحويل ملف PSB إلى صورة JPG برمجيًا باستخدام Java:

// حدد مسار الإدخال لملف PSB       
String sourceFileName = dataDir + "Simple.psb";

// تحميل ملف إدخال PSB     
PsdLoadOptions options = new PsdLoadOptions();
PsdImage image = (PsdImage)Image.load(sourceFileName, options);

// تهيئة كائن فئة JpegOptions
JpegOptions jpgoptions = new JpegOptions();
jpgoptions.setQuality(95);
       
// تحويل ملف PSB إلى JPG
image.save(dataDir + "Simple_output.jpg",jpgoptions);

تحويل PSB إلى تنسيق PSD باستخدام لغة جافا

على الرغم من أن تنسيقات ملفات PSB و PSD مترابطة ، لا تزال هناك بعض الاختلافات بين تنسيقات الملفات. يمكنك تحويل ملف PSB إلى PSD بسرعة وكفاءة باتباع الخطوات المذكورة أدناه:

  1. حدد مسار ملف إدخال PSB
  2. تحميل ملف إدخال PSB
  3. تهيئة PsdOptions مثيل الفئة
  4. تحويل ملف PSB إلى ملف PSD

تتيح لك هذه الخطوات البسيطة تصدير ملف PSB إلى صورة PSD بدقة عالية. يوضح الكود أدناه كيفية تحويل PSB إلى PSD برمجيًا باستخدام Java:

// حدد مسار إدخال ملف PSB
String sourceFileName = dataDir + "2layers.psb";
     
// تحميل ملف إدخال PSB       
PsdImage image = (PsdImage)Image.load(sourceFileName);          

// تهيئة مثيل فئة PsdOptions
PsdOptions options = new PsdOptions();
options.setFileFormatVersion(FileFormatVersion.Psd);
       
// تحويل ملف PSB إلى ملف PSD
image.save(dataDir + "ConvertFromPsb_out.psd",options);

استنتاج

في هذه المقالة ، اكتشفنا كيفية تصدير أو تحويل ملفات PSB. على وجه الخصوص ، تعلمنا تحويل PSB إلى PDF و JPG و PSD برمجيًا باستخدام Java. وبالمثل ، يمكنك استكشاف الكثير من الميزات الأخرى من خلال استكشاف وثائق API ، أو عن طريق تجربة أمثلة رمز المصدر. في حالة وجود أي استفسار ، يمكنك التواصل معنا عبر منتديات الدعم المجاني.

أنظر أيضا